Fig. 9From: Modulating phenylalanine metabolism by L. acidophilus alleviates alcohol-related liver disease through enhancing intestinal barrier functionL. acidophilus supplementation decreased intestinal phenylalanine of ALD mice. A PLS-DA showed that there were significant differences in intestinal metabolites of ALD mice with and without L. acidophilus supplementation. B Comparison of the abundances of L-phenylalanine, phenylpyruvic acid and 3-phenyllactic acid between ALD mice with and without L. acidophilus supplementation. C Comparison of the ratios of phenylpyruvic acid to L-phenylalanine and and 3-phenyllactic acid to L-phenylalanine between ALD mice with and without L. acidophilus supplementation. n.s, no significant. *p value < 0.05Back to article page
